About

Li‐Chih Wang is a scholar working on Developmental and Educational Psychology, Statistics and Probability and Cognitive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Li‐Chih Wang has authored 52 papers receiving a total of 398 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 34 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ology, 22 papers in Statistics and Probability and 21 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Li‐Chih Wang’s work include Reading and Literacy Development (32 papers), Cognitive and developmental aspects of mathematical skills (22 papers) and Neurobiology of Language and Bilingualism (8 papers). Li‐Chih Wang is often cited by papers focused on Reading and Literacy Development (32 papers), Cognitive and developmental aspects of mathematical skills (22 papers) and Neurobiology of Language and Bilingualism (8 papers). Li‐Chih Wang collaborates with scholars based in Taiwan, Hong Kong and United States. Li‐Chih Wang's co-authors include Duo Liu, Ji‐Kang Chen, Kevin Kien Hoa Chung, Ching-Wen Chang, Chung‐Ying Lin, Huimin Chen, Xiaomin Li, Chih‐Ming Liu, Hsin‐Yuan Miao and L. Saravanan and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health, Frontiers in Psychology and Child Abuse & Neglect.
